The Mercer Mustangs will take on the Cochranton Cardinals at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. Both come into the game b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Mercer took a loss when they played away from home on Friday, but their home fans gave them all the motivation they needed on Saturday. They secured a 47-42 W over Maplewood.
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Cochranton). They came out on top against West Middlesex by a score of 61-52 on Monday.
Cochranton had a senior duo take command as Eve Pfeiffer dropped a double-double on 27 points and 11 rebounds and Marley Rodax went 7 of 10 on her way to 16 points and three steals. As a matter of fact, that's the most points Pfeiffer has scored all season.
Cochranton sm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 20 offensive rebounds.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least eight offensive boards in six consecutive matchups.
Cochranton's win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 4-4. As for Mercer, they now have a winning record of 4-3.
Mercer might still be hurting after the 60-35 loss they got from Cochranton when the teams last played back in February of 2022. Thankfully for Mercer, Jaylin Mcgill (who dropped a double-double on 17 points and ten boards) won't be suiting up this time. Will that be enough to change the final result?
